Python之系统交互(调用系统命令)subprocess
ipcpu 7年前 (2018-06-13) 4330浏览
在早期的Python版本中,我们主要是通过os.system()、os.popen().read()等函数来执行命令行指令的,另外还有一个很少使用的commands模块。但是从Python 2.4开始官方文档中建议使用的是subprocess模块。(...
ipcpu 7年前 (2018-06-13) 4330浏览
在早期的Python版本中,我们主要是通过os.system()、os.popen().read()等函数来执行命令行指令的,另外还有一个很少使用的commands模块。但是从Python 2.4开始官方文档中建议使用的是subprocess模块。(...
ipcpu 7年前 (2018-05-22) 21021浏览
Kafka消费积压Lag监控工具Burrow的使用.md 一、概述 Kafka是业内流行的日志队列处理软件,使用极为广泛,但是关于对Kafka的监控问题,网上的文章和相关的软件就比较少了。 KafkaManager算是几个开源软件里做的比较好的。可...
ipcpu 7年前 (2018-05-17) 7674浏览
一、TFO概述 为了改善web应用相应时延,google发布了通过修改TCP协议利用三次握手时进行数据交换的TFO(TCP fast open,RFC 7413)。 TFO允许在TCP握手期间发送和接收初始SYN分组中的数据。如果客户端和服务器都支持...
ipcpu 7年前 (2018-03-08) 1971浏览
Codis集群的搭建和使用.md 一、概述 Codis是豌豆荚开源的一款产品,一个分布式Redis解决方案,与官方cluster的纯P2P模式不同,Codis采用的是Proxy-based的方案。 当前的版本是Codis 3.x,使用go语言开发,...
ipcpu 7年前 (2018-03-02) 4868浏览
Flume进阶Interceptor和监控.md 一、Flume的Interceptor Flume中的拦截器(interceptor),用户Source读取events发送到Sink的时候,在events header中加入一些有用的信息,或者对e...
ipcpu 7年前 (2017-10-15) 7616浏览
zabbix agent cpu占用100%排查.md 发现问题 运维同学发现某几台机器zabbix agent占用了cpu达到了100%,如下图。 初步分析和猜测 因该服务器TCP连接数过多,超过10万,高峰期可达20万。ss统计数据如下 [r...
ipcpu 7年前 (2017-07-07) 20967浏览
Linux系统中网络PPS值测量及其优化.md 概述 网络设备的转发性能以“包转发性能”来表示,即设备在单位时间内能够处理多少个“包”,这决定了设备转发能力的强弱。 包转发性能比较常见的单位是“PPS”,即Packet Per Second(...
ipcpu 8年前 (2017-06-18) 1998浏览
Redis集群Cluster搭建.md 一、Redis 集群Cluster 简介 Redis 是一个开源的 key-value 存储系统,由于出众的性能,大部分互联网企业都用来做服务器端缓存。Redis 在3.0版本前只支持单实例模式,虽然支持主从模...
ipcpu 8年前 (2017-05-28) 4821浏览
基于mcroute实现Memcached的高可用HA.md 概述 Mcrouter 是一个基于Memcached 协议的路由器,它是 Facebook缓存架构的核心组件,在峰值的时候,它能够处理每秒50亿次的请求。目前已经开源,可以去github上下...
ipcpu 8年前 (2017-05-12) 4958浏览
引入 在openstack私有云平台部署了Zabbix后,发现承载云主机的物理机(CentOS7),zabbix监控图有些异常,如下,CPU利用率这张图默认情况应该是图像占满100%的,而这里却只有不到80%。 解决 一开始怀疑是Zabbix客户端...